Output 3daf89ee71e7eb369afdd1c5880ea89c986c4a30e2566e9ed80aeacc8678a657:29

value
76016
script pubkey
OP_0 OP_PUSHBYTES_20 7045188dec888f7e1f34dd625e90ad401f87a21f
address
bc1qwpz33r0v3z8hu8e5m439ay9dgq0c0gsl2rdpr9
transaction
3daf89ee71e7eb369afdd1c5880ea89c986c4a30e2566e9ed80aeacc8678a657
spent
true